US 7,565,501 B2
Storage controller and data management method
Katsuo Mogi, Odawara (Japan); Koji Nagata, Kaisei (Japan); Shoji Kodama, Sagamihara (Japan); and Ikuya Yagisawa, Machida (Japan)
Assigned to Hitachi, Ltd., Tokyo (Japan)
Filed on Feb. 22, 2006, as Appl. No. 11/358,051.
Claims priority of application No. 2006-005580 (JP), filed on Jan. 13, 2006.
Prior Publication US 2007/0168629 A1, Jul. 19, 2007
Int. Cl. G06F 12/00 (2006.01)
U.S. Cl. 711—162  [707/204] 16 Claims
OG exemplary drawing
 
1. A storage controller providing a volume for storing data transmitted from a host system, comprising:
a management unit for managing said data written into a first block area configured in said volume, or into a second block area configured in said first block area which is smaller than said first block area;
a snapshot acquisition unit for acquiring a snapshot of said volume at a prescribed timing; and
a transfer unit for transferring said written data of said volume and said snapshot acquired by said snapshot acquisition unit to an external device including a volume also configured with said first block area and said second block area to backup said written data and said snapshot therein,
wherein data to be backed-up to the external device is transferred in a data size of the first or second block area depending upon a size of said data,
said transfer unit transfers said data with said first block area when said data is not being managed with said management unit in said second block area, and
when a total value of the areas of said second block area is greater than a prescribed threshold value, said management unit deletes all areas of said second block area that it is managing.